How Columbus and El Paso Compare

Housing (11% cheaper in El Paso)

The average 1-bedroom apartment in El Paso rents for $950/month compared to $1,191/month in Columbus. Median home prices: $225,000 in El Paso vs $290,000 in Columbus.

Taxes

Ohio has a progressive state income tax from 0.0% to 3.5%. Texas has no state income tax. On a $75,000 salary, moving to El Paso would save you about $1,346/year in taxes alone.

Overall Cost of Living

El Paso's overall cost of living is 5.9% lower than Columbus, based on the BEA Regional Price Parity index (where 100 = national average).Columbus: 95.5, El Paso: 89.9.
